Quick planning answer
One gallon of propane contains about 91,452 BTU. An 80,000 BTU/h furnace that burns for four hours uses about 3.5 gallons. Your water heater, range, dryer, fireplace, and generator can add more.
Use the input rating on the appliance label
Enter input BTU/h, not heating output. The burner uses the input amount of fuel. Efficiency tells you how much of that fuel becomes useful heat. Modulating equipment often runs below its highest rating, so using full input for every burner hour gives a cautious estimate.
Generator fuel use changes a lot with electrical load. If the manual lists fuel use at 25%, 50%, and full load, use that table instead of the simple BTU rating.
Do not use one weather day for the whole year
Four furnace hours may make sense on a cold day. It does not make sense in July. Model a cold month, a mild month, and a summer month separately. Then compare those results with delivery records or local heating degree days.
- Write down the tank level before and after a known week.
- Record gallons delivered, outdoor temperature, and generator or fireplace use.
- Watch for a sudden increase that continues after the weather warms. Ask for service or a leak check.
- Never use a flame or a homemade test to look for a propane leak. If you smell gas, leave the area and follow your supplier's emergency steps.
Tank volume is not the only limit
A 500-gallon tank normally holds about 400 gallons when filled to 80%. In cold weather, several large burners may need propane vapor faster than the tank can make it, even when liquid remains. Your supplier should size the tank, regulators, and pipes for the connected appliances and local climate.
Use days per fill to help plan deliveries. Keep the reserve level required by your supplier. If the tank runs empty, air can enter the system and a leak check may be required before service starts again.
Questions people ask before buying
How many BTU are in a gallon of propane?
A common planning value is about 91,452 BTU per gallon. Divide the total appliance input used by 91,452 to find the estimated gallons.
How much propane does an 80,000 BTU furnace use?
At full input, it uses about 0.875 gallon for each burner hour. A furnace that cycles or lowers its output may use less. Track burner time or deliveries for a closer number.
Why can a propane tank only be filled to 80%?
The empty space lets liquid propane expand when its temperature changes. That is why a tank's listed water capacity is larger than the propane delivered during a normal full fill.
Can this calculator predict winter deliveries?
It can turn an appliance schedule into estimated gallons. To plan deliveries, you also need past delivery records, thermostat run time, weather, home heat loss, generator use, and your supplier's reserve rules.
Method, sources and limits
For each appliance, the tool multiplies input BTU/h by daily burner hours. It adds all six appliance totals and divides by 91,452 BTU per gallon. The monthly estimate uses 30.4375 days. The yearly estimate uses 365 days.
The tool treats 80% of the tank's water capacity as the filled level, subtracts the refill percentage you enter, and divides the remaining gallons by daily use to find days until refill. The result does not include changing burner output, weather, regulator limits, or how fast the tank can make vapor.
